Nonnicotine vapes may be marketed as safe, but many still contain chemicals, have unknown health effects, and aren't FDAregulated. Teens are using them more ofteneven alongside nicotine vapes. No ecigarette is risk free. health risks e cigarettes Vaping has become common, but it's important to know what you're inhaling. Many e-cigarettes contain nicotine, heavy metals like nickel and lead, and chemicals that can harm your lungs and overall health.
